What is kinesiology?


Kinesiology is a holistic complementary therapy that works on every aspect of health - physical, emotional, psychological, nutritional and spiritual - to relieve the stress that prevents us from achieving what we really want in life: health, private and professional success, wellbeing and happiness.

It is the most advanced method available to date for determining imbalances in the body and finding the most effective treatment for a person.

how does it work?


The core therapeutic technique used by kinesiologists is muscle testing. Muscle testing involves slow, gentle pressure against a muscle in its most contracted position to gather information from the subconscious (the past) and from the body's cellular memory.

We use the information to identify the trauma or stressor and release any blockages, using a combination of Chinese and Western techniques, in order to help the energy flow freely again and assist self-healing.
 
We aim for lasting positive change - therefore we work on causes and not symptoms. For best results, expect two or three sessions to see a real improvement.
